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for 2020 was RMB 227,656,041,000, a decrease of 0.59% compared to RMB 229,010,833,000 in 2019[41]. - Net profit for 2020 was RMB 13,823,060,000, showing a slight decrease from RMB 13,823,701,000 in 2019[42]. - Basic earnings per share for 2020 were RMB 0.39, down 4.88% from RMB 0.41 in 2019[41]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was CNY 11.331 billion, down 3.93% compared to the previous year[84]. - Operating revenue decreased by 0.59% to RMB 227,656,041, while operating costs increased by 0.46% to RMB 176,954,601[86]. - The gross profit margin for railway equipment was 24.78%, down 0.23 percentage points year-on-year, while the gross profit margin for urban rail and infrastructure increased by 1.80 percentage points to 19.44%[87]. - Revenue from the new industry segment increased by 33.88% to RMB 71,723,810, but the gross profit margin decreased by 2.56 percentage points to 21.11%[90]. - The company reported a significant increase in revenue, with a year-over-year growth of 15% in the latest fiscal year[197]. - The company has set a future outlook with a revenue guidance of $1.5 billion for the next fiscal year, representing a 10% increase from the previous year[199]. Assets and Liabilities - Total assets as of December 31, 2020, reached RMB 392,380,368,000, an increase of 2.30% from RMB 383,572,485,000 in 2019[42]. - Total liabilities as of December 31, 2020, were RMB 223,238,804,000, a decrease of 0.67% from RMB 224,744,003,000 in 2019[42]. - The total equity attributable to shareholders of the parent company was RMB 143,021,347,000, an increase of 5.25% from RMB 135,893,631,000 in 2019[42]. - The asset-liability ratio was 56.89%, a decrease of 1.70 percentage points from the beginning of the year[84]. - By the end of 2020, CRRC's production capacity included 547 new high-speed trains per year, 1,530 locomotives, 2,300 passenger cars, 51,500 freight cars, and 11,840 urban rail vehicles[68]. Cash Flow and Dividends - The net cash flow from operating activities for 2020 was negative RMB 2,032,393,000, compared to positive RMB 22,530,536,000 in 2019[42]. - The company plans to distribute a cash dividend of RMB 0.18 per share, totaling RMB 5,166,000,000, based on a total share capital of 28,698,864,088 shares[41]. - The cash dividend for 2019 was RMB 0.15 per share, amounting to RMB 4.30483 billion, accounting for 36% of the net profit attributable to shareholders[142]. - The proposed cash dividend for 2020 is subject to adjustments if there are changes in total share capital due to convertible bonds or other factors[141]. - The company’s cash dividends have shown a consistent increase over the past three years, with 2020 being the highest payout ratio at 46%[142]. Research and Development - Research and development expenses increased to RMB 13,349,896,000 in 2020, up from RMB 12,017,162,000 in 2019[42]. - The company's total R&D investment for 2020 was RMB 13.579 billion, accounting for 5.96% of operating revenue[98][100]. - The number of R&D personnel reached 35,273, representing 21.48% of the total workforce[98]. - The company established 7 collaborative innovation teams focusing on advanced rail transit technologies, including magnetic levitation and new materials[100]. - The company is investing $200 million in R&D for innovative technologies aimed at reducing operational costs by 20% over the next three years[199]. Market Position and Strategy - The company maintained a leading position in the global rail transit equipment manufacturing industry, receiving a "China Sovereign Rating" from international rating agencies[49]. - The company is committed to deepening market-oriented reforms and exploring new models for state-owned enterprise reform[50]. - The company is expanding its international business by establishing a global marketing and regional management system, focusing on overseas market development along the "Belt and Road" initiative[61]. - The company aims to enhance its core competitiveness in urban rail and infrastructure by accelerating technological and product innovation[57]. - The company is actively pursuing opportunities in the "Belt and Road" initiative and urban rail transit construction to enhance its market position[125]. Risks and Challenges - The company faces various risks including strategic, market, product quality, and foreign operation risks, which are detailed in the report[8]. - The company acknowledges ongoing complexities and risks due to the pandemic[50]. - The company faces strategic risks due to structural changes in customer demand for railway equipment and the shift towards integrated lifecycle services[133]. - The company is exposed to exchange rate risks due to increased international operations, which may lead to foreign exchange losses[137]. - The company is addressing structural overcapacity in its rail transit segments through business restructuring and capacity reduction strategies[140]. Environmental and Social Responsibility - The company reported a total charitable donation of approximately RMB 31,226 thousand during the reporting period[174]. - The company has 9 subsidiaries recognized as green factory demonstration enterprises by the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ology[179]. - The company has implemented a gradual phase-out of coal-fired boilers, opting for purchased steam or social heating, enhancing its environmental compliance[182]. - The company achieved a non-compliance rate of zero for its wastewater and air emissions against the set standards[182]. - The company has publicly disclosed environmental information as required by local environmental authorities, promoting transparency[185]. Governance and Leadership - The board of directors includes Sun Yongcai as Chairman and President, and other key members such as Liu Qi Liang and Li Guoan[188]. - The company has undergone changes in its board composition, with new appointments and resignations noted in the reporting period[192]. - The leadership team has collectively over 30 years of experience in the railway and transportation industry, ensuring expertise in operational and strategic initiatives[194]. - The company emphasizes governance and compliance with age-related resignations of board members to ensure effective leadership[192]. - The company is actively involved in various industry associations, enhancing its influence and collaboration within the transportation sector[194].
